Transaction 34ddf82bda23c069596ae3b5b9f06d3a83738ec5e9a999f2444a860c886ce221
1 Input
2 Outputs
- 34ddf82bda23c069596ae3b5b9f06d3a83738ec5e9a999f2444a860c886ce221:0
- 34ddf82bda23c069596ae3b5b9f06d3a83738ec5e9a999f2444a860c886ce221:1
value 138323
address 19s1ZiHRD6rqkzph4jta6DmDLYnDkGmbLF
value 35898
address bc1q583uv77nlgdvg9yynhg9373y9d56jtfhnhnk9k